From: Kairui Song <kasong@tencent.com>
Subject: mm/mglru: rename variables related to aging and rotation
Date: Fri, 24 Apr 2026 01:43:13 +0800

The current variable name isn't helpful.  Make the variable names more
meaningful.

Only naming change, no behavior change.
